Practical Application of Heavy Truck Gears

The practical application of heavy truck gears runs through the entire transmission chain of heavy trucks, covering multiple scenarios such as freight transportation and engineering transportation. Their adaptability and reliability directly determine the operating efficiency, load-carrying capacity and driving safety of heavy trucks, and they are the core support for heavy trucks to achieve heavy-load transportation. Different from the application scenarios of ordinary vehicle gears, the practical application of heavy truck gears needs to achieve differentiated adaptation around the load requirements and driving road conditions of different working conditions, balancing power transmission and component durability.

In the long-distance freight scenario, heavy truck gears are mainly used in core assemblies such as gearboxes and drive axles. Their core function is to realize power deceleration and torque increase, convert the power output by the engine into traction force suitable for long-distance heavy loads, and optimize the gear ratio design to reduce power loss during high-speed driving, helping to reduce fuel consumption in long-distance transportation. For the application of heavy trucks in complex road conditions such as construction sites, heavy truck gears need to focus on adapting to the working conditions of frequent climbing and heavy-load starting and stopping. By strengthening the tooth surface structure and improving impact resistance, they can cope with the bumpy and dusty environment of the construction site, avoiding failures such as tooth wear and fracture affecting the construction progress.

In the practical application of special heavy trucks (such as cold chain transportation and hazardous chemical transportation), heavy truck gears also need to adapt to special operation needs. For example, the gears of cold chain heavy trucks need to cooperate with the vehicle's temperature control system, select low-temperature resistant materials to avoid the decrease of tooth surface hardness and lubrication failure in low-temperature environments; the gears of hazardous chemical transportation heavy trucks need to improve operational stability, reduce transmission noise and vibration, and reduce potential safety hazards. In daily application, it is necessary to select heavy truck gears of corresponding specifications according to the operation scenario and load level of the heavy truck, and do a good job in regular inspection and lubrication maintenance to ensure that they continuously play a stable transmission role in practical application and ensure the efficient and safe operation of heavy trucks.
